Research interests

Application of artificial intelligence in clinical diagnosis systems

Developing models/methods for analysis of DNA or protein sequence data

Protein-ligand, Protein-protein and Protein-DNA interactions analysis and prediction

Protein post-translational modification anaylsis

Computer- aided drug design

 

Software

SeqSubPred:  a web tool for prediction of deleterious amino acid substitutions

SeqPalm: Prediction of protein S-palmitoylation sites and the corresponding loss/gain of palmitoylation sites by amino acid variations

HydPred: A novel method and web tool for identification of protein hydroxylation sites
